What is the process to request a residence certificate in Argentina?

The process to request a residence certificate in Argentina varies depending on the jurisdiction. Generally, you must go to the police station corresponding to your address and present your ID and proof of current address, such as a utility bill in your name. The police station will verify your details and issue the residence certificate.

What is the penalty for drug trafficking in Peru?

Penalties for drug trafficking in Peru vary depending on the amount and type of drugs. They can range from several years in prison to life imprisonment in serious cases.
